Please use this identifier to cite or link to this item: https://hdl.handle.net/10216/85885
Full metadata record
DC FieldValueLanguage
dc.creatorTiago Manuel Lourenço Azevedo
dc.date.accessioned2022-09-16T08:42:49Z-
dc.date.available2022-09-16T08:42:49Z-
dc.date.issued2015-07-14
dc.date.submitted2015-09-10
dc.identifier.othersigarra:36018
dc.identifier.urihttps://hdl.handle.net/10216/85885-
dc.descriptionActualmente, as universidades e as empresas de todo o mundo têm uma enorme necessidade de metodologias que permitam simular e modelar. No que diz respeito ao tráfego e transportes, fazer mudanças físicas nas redes reais de trânsito poderia ser altamente dispendioso, estando dependente de decisões políticas e podendo ser altamente prejudicial ao meio ambiente. Por isso, a simulação é muito usada em tais cenários. No entanto, o uso de simulação para estudar ou analisar um domínio ou problema específico pode não ser trivial e podem ser necessárias diversas ferramentas, com diferentes resoluções e perspectivas de domínio, causando o aumento de problemas relacionados com interoperabilidade. Com as recentes evoluções no âmbito do cloud computing e do Software-as-a-Service (SaaS), existe um novo paradigma onde o software de simulação é usado sob a forma de serviços. Assim, o Simulation Software-as-a-Service (SimSaaS) é muito benéfico para melhor explorar o grande número de plataformas e armazenamento que a simulação precisa, e que o Cloud Computing pode fornecer. Para ultrapassar os problemas supra mencionados, o principal objetivo desta dissertação foi apresentar o atual estado da arte na área e propor uma plataforma de simulação de transporte direcionada a agentes, através da cloud, por meio de serviços. Utilizou-se o standard HLA (High Level Architecture) da IEEE para interoperabilidade de simuladores e agentes para controlo e coordenação. Para que tal seja possível, foi imperativo construir, através de uma revisão sistemática da literatura, o conhecimento necessário para desenvolver a plataforma. Os estudos revistos foram comparados e sumarisados na forma de uma taxonomia do trabalho de pesquisa que representa as oportunidades de pesquisa mais importantes para os próximos anos. A arquitectura e os principais cenários de utilização da plataforma foram detalhados. A partir daí, o subconjunto de características mais importantes foi seleccionado na forma de uma prova de conceito. A sua implementação foi explicada indicando o software utilizado (OpenStack, Pitch pRTI, SUMO e EBPS) e o cenário de simulação escolhido. Por fim, foram conduzidas algumas experiências para se perceber a melhor abordagem no controlo e lançamento de máquinas virtuais. Esta análise é importante para se obter uma melhor performance em simulações utilizando a infraestrutura desenvolvida.
dc.description.abstractNowadays, universities and companies all around the world have a huge need for simulation and modelling methodologies. In the particular case of traffic and transportation, making physical modifications in the real traffic networks could be highly expensive, dependent on political decisions and could be highly disruptive to the environment. Therefore, simulation is broadly used in such scenarios. However, while studying a specific domain or problem, analysis through simulation may not be trivial and very often requires several simulation tools, with different resolutions and domain perspectives, hence raising interoperability issues. With the recent evolutions in cloud computing and Software-as-a-Service (SaaS), there is a new paradigm where simulation software is used in the form of services. So, Simulation Software-as-a-Service (SimSaaS) is very beneficial to better exploit the huge amount of platforms and storage that simulation needs per se - and Cloud Computing is able to provide such resources. To address issues arising in this novel perspective the main goal of this dissertation was to present the current state of the art in the field and to propose an agent-directed transportation simulation platform, through the cloud, by means of services. It was used the IEEE standard HLA (High Level Architecture) for simulator interoperability and agents for controlling and coordination. To do so, it was necessary to build, through a systematic literature review, the body of knowledge needed to develop such platform. The reviewed studies were compared and summarised leading to the creation of a taxonomy of the research work, which represent the front research opportunities for the next years. The main scenarios and architecture of the platform were detailed. The proof of concept's implementation was further explained including the used software (OpenStack, Pitch pRTI, SUMO and EBPS) and the chosen simulation scenario. Finally, some experiments were made about the best approach to manage and launch VMs (Virtual Machines). Such analysis is very important to have better performance in simulations under the developed infrastructure.
dc.language.isoeng
dc.rightsopenAccess
dc.rights.urihttps://creativecommons.org/licenses/by-nc/4.0/
dc.subjectEngenharia electrotécnica, electrónica e informática
dc.subjectElectrical engineering, Electronic engineering, Information engineering
dc.titleFrom the Ground to the Cloud: Towards an Integrated Transportation Simulation Platform
dc.typeDissertação
dc.contributor.uportoFaculdade de Engenharia
dc.identifier.tid201808625
dc.subject.fosCiências da engenharia e tecnologias::Engenharia electrotécnica, electrónica e informática
dc.subject.fosEngineering and technology::Electrical engineering, Electronic engineering, Information engineering
thesis.degree.disciplineMestrado Integrado em Engenharia Informática e Computação
thesis.degree.grantorFaculdade de Engenharia
thesis.degree.grantorUniversidade do Porto
thesis.degree.level1
Appears in Collections:FEUP - Dissertação

Files in This Item:
File Description SizeFormat 
36018.pdfFrom the Ground to the Cloud: Towards an Integrated Transportation Simulation Platform5.6 MBAdobe PDFThumbnail
View/Open


This item is licensed under a Creative Commons License Creative Commons